A third global biosimilars week awareness campaign running from 14-18 November has been launched by the International Generic and Biosimilar Medicines Association, with the IGBA also taking this opportunity to launch a new white paper that urges the uptake of recommendations from the World Health Organization’s latest revised biosimilars guideline from earlier this year.
